La the event <br />that a Twenty -five Dollar ($25.00) administrative charge is to be <br />certified for the unpaid water charges, pursuant to Section <br />1601.340, the Twenty -five Dollar ($25.00) administrative charge for <br />unpaid sewer charges shall be waived. <br />(F) Exceptions to the annual sewer rates set forth above <br />Shall apply to senior citizens and disabled citizens who otherwise <br />would be subject to sewer use charges. Any such senior citizen or <br />disabled citizen, as hereinafter defined, shall become eligible for <br />the reduced rate of 50% of the annual sewer rate by signing an <br />affidavit affirming:that he or she is owner and head of the <br />household at his or her address and is receiving Retirement <br />Survivors Insurance or Disability Insurance under the Social <br />Security Act. Affidavits for this purpose shall be provided by the <br />City <br />and acknowledged by a Notary Public. For the purpose of this sub- <br />section, a senior citizen shall be a person sixty -five (65) years <br />of age or older, the owner and head of a household, and entitled to <br />benefits under the Social Security Act. A disabled person is <br />defined as one who is sufficiently disabled as to qualify for <br />Disability Insurance benefits under the Social Security Act and is <br />also the owner and head of his or her household. The reduced rate <br />established by this Ordinance shall be subject to change by <br />resolution of the City Council. <br />205 -12 <br />Page 72 <br />
